Residential and non-residential art course: Fine Art & Applied Art (Commercial Art with Computer Applications) .
1)
Fine Art: History of Indian Art, Oriental Art, And Western Art.
Painting class
( Water colour, Oil colour, Acrylic colour , Tempera, Mixed media, Gouache etc. application and practical work),
Creativity and Art exhibition.

Duration of Art course :

Beginners Level ( art history and practice of out door study), Intermediate Level ( art application, technical sides and digital, overall concept), And Professional Level (perception of creativity, grooming into a professional ).
Courses are optional. Each level consists of 12 months, 4 days of a week; 4 hours class a day (and 3 hours a day for non residential students). Time schedule: For residential students 7A.M. to 11 A.M. (And non- residential 7A.M. to 10 A.M.).

2) Applied Arts : Drawing, basics of commercial arts and application, Computer
application
, outdoor study

Duration: Two years. 4 days of a week; 4 hours class a day (and 3 hours a day for non residential students). Time schedule: For residential students 6P.M. to 10 P.M. ( and for non residentials 6P.M. to 9 P.M.)
Eligibility: Age minimum 18 years old; Academic background should be minimum viii (eight) standard, Indian citizen, non- criminal record certificate from local institution and an assurance of complying fair law and order.
